What companies run services between Grenoble, France and Aix-en-Provence, France?

FlixBus operates a bus from Grenoble to Aix-en-Provence 4 times a day. Tickets cost €22–40 and the journey takes 3h 30m. BlaBlaCar Bus also services this route 3 times a day. Alternatively, you can take a train from Grenoble to Aix En Provence via Valence Tgv Rhone-Alpes Sud and Marseille St Charles in around 3h 53m.
